Housing complex to be established southern Karbala

Karbala (IraqiNews.com) The investment commission in Karbala province set the cornerstone for the housing complex of Zahra neighborhood in Hindiya district of southern Karbala.

The deputy chairman of Karbala investment commission, Ahmed al-Maliki, mentioned in statement received by IraqiNews.com ”The Inma of Iraq company set the cornerstone to establish (500) housing units,” noting that “The project will contain an elementary school, kindergarten, nursery, markets, public parks and the infrastructure services.”

he added that “The total area of the housing project reaches (60 acre) with total cost of IQD (72) billion.”

The statement pointed out ”The aim of this project is to relief the housing crisis and reduce the unemployment rate in the province in addition to applying the modern technology in construction sector.”
